The main objective of this role is to take on customer accounts after equipment has been purchased with one of our sales representatives. Daily responsibilities include: obtaining necessary documents to legally close the sale, updating customers on progress, collecting payments, invoicing, as well as coordinating with our other teams in the department, field locations, and other shops across North America.
Vehicle sale coordination to include: invoicing and document completion, confirming with field locations that vehicles are ready for pickup, collecting payments and providing customer assistance
Obtaining signed documents from customers
Entering sales related information into SalesForce.com and Fleetnet systems
Answering customer and associate phone calls that come into the department
Updating Microsoft Access and excel spreadsheets for report generation
Other projects and tasks as assigned by supervisor
Schedule: 9-5:30pm M-F
On-site during training, then hybrid schedule
